How Common Is The Last Name Kizler? popularity and diffusion
The surname Kizler is the 791,719th most widespread surname globally, held by approximately 1 in 20,470,635 people. This last name occurs mostly in Europe, where 65 percent of Kizler reside; 45 percent reside in Western Europe and 45 percent reside in Germanic Europe.
This surname is most frequently held in Germany, where it is held by 159 people, or 1 in 506,324. In Germany Kizler is most frequent in: Baden-Württemberg, where 97 percent are found, North Rhine-Westphalia, where 1 percent are found and Bavaria, where 1 percent are found. Barring Germany Kizler occurs in 10 countries. It is also common in The United States, where 22 percent are found and Poland, where 17 percent are found.
